range noun 2amount between particular limits 变化幅度ADJECTIVE | VERB + RANGE | PREPOSITION ADJECTIVEbroad, wide 广阔的范围narrow 狭窄的范围normal 正常范围ability, age, price, size, temperature, etc. 能力范围、年龄范围、价格幅度、尺寸范围、温度范围等VERB + RANGEcover, encompass, feature, include, span 涵盖⋯的范围;包括⋯的范围◆The books cover the full range of reading abilities.这些书涵盖了各种阅读能力的读者。show 显示范围◆The experiments show a surprisingly wide range of results.这些实验显现了大量不同的结果,令人惊讶。extend, increase 扩展/增大范围◆These books are designed to extend the range of children's language.这些书旨在拓展儿童的语言能力。limit, restrict 限制范围◆Many factors limit women's range of job choices.妇女选择工作的范围受到许多因素的制约。PREPOSITIONacross a/the range 在⋯级别之间◆There is considerable variation in ability across the range.不同级别之间能力差别很大。in a/the range 在⋯范围内◆Most of the students are in the 17-21 age range.大多数学生的年龄在 17 至 21 岁之间。outside a/the range 在⋯范围之外◆No, that's completely outside my price range.不行,那完全超出了我能承受的价格范围。within a/the range 在⋯范围之内◆The level of mistakes is within the acceptable range of standards for a public organization.对一个公共组织来说,错误数还算在可接受的范围之内。range of ⋯的范围◆a broad range of abilities能力差别很大 |
